Top Advantages Of Setting Up A Business In Ecuador

6 advantages of setting up a business in ecuador

Here are the benefits of registering a business in Ecuador:

1. Strategic Location

  • One of the advantages of setting up a business in Ecuador is its advantageous position in South America which serves as a crucial entry point to the marketplaces of the region. 
  • Its proximity to worldwide trade routes and accessibility to airlines and maritime ports make it an excellent place for companies wishing to grow in the South American markets. 
  • This is another one of the benefits of registering a business in Ecuador as it connects businesses in the nation to other regions thereby making it easier for entrepreneurs to trade.

2. Expanding Domestic Market

  • Another one of the reasons for registering a company in Ecuador is the nation’s growing population. 
  • Ecuador has a population of over 18 million individuals, giving business owners access to a thriving and expanding market. 
  • Another one of the advantages of setting up a business in Ecuador is the nation’s growing middle class, which is increasing demand for goods and services among consumers. 
  • This will further encourage the company to produce more goods and services, boosting company profitability.

3. Excellent Investment Environment

  • Another one of the benefits of registering a business in Ecuador is the nation’s favorable investment environment. 
  • The legislation of Ecuador guarantees that domestic as well as international investors shall be treated fairly and equitably. This implies that the investors are guaranteed equal privileges by the legislation thereby, making the nation a favorable choice for entrepreneurs. 
  • Another one of the reasons for registering a company in Ecuador is that to encourage economic expansion and encourage bring foreign investment, the nation provides a variety of alluring investment incentives. 
  • These incentives include tax reductions and exemptions as well as faster registration procedures. 
  • The legal system of Ecuador further guarantees the freedom of entrepreneurship while simultaneously encouraging private investment in the nation’s economy.

4. Developed Transportation Facilities

  • Another one of the advantages of setting up a business in Ecuador is the availability of highly developed infrastructural facilities in the nation. 
  • A well-developed infrastructure enables international trade, which makes it simpler for enterprises to engage in commercial operations. 
  • As such, Ecuador is well-connected to its neighbors due to its sophisticated transportation system and vast road network. 
  • Additionally, Ecuador has several ports, including the ports of Guayaquil and Esmeraldas, and enterprises in the nation can easily reach to other cities via its domestic airlines. 
  • This is another one of the reasons for registering a company in Ecuador as all this may assist the country’s businesses to develop and prosper.

5. Free Trade Zones (FTZs)

  • Another one of the benefits of registering a business in Ecuador is the availability of free trade zones that offers firms several advantages. 
  • Investing in Ecuador is made considerably simpler by the nation’s FTZs, which makes importing raw materials and exporting final or semi-processed commodities, all of which are completely exempt from taxes. 
  • There are no restrictions on the repatriation of revenues for businesses based in the nation’s free trade zones which is another one of the benefits of registering a business in Ecuador.

6. Free Trade Agreements (FTAs)

  • Another one of the reasons for registering a company in Ecuador is the free trade agreement that has been negotiated with the European Union. 
  • With the help of these accords, Ecuadorian business owners now have easier access to the consumer market of the EU, which consists of over 447 million individuals. 
  • In addition, Ecuadorian businesses will no longer be subject to export taxes when shipping goods to any EU member state as a result of this agreement which is another one of the advantages of setting up a business in Ecuador.
